Jylamvo (methotrexate oral solution)

type of Immunosuppressants, DMARDs, Immunomodulators, Antineoplastics, Antimetabolite

Jylamvo (methotrexate) is a folate analog metabolic inhibitor indicated for the treatment of adults with acute lymphoblastic leukemia (ALL) as part of a combination chemotherapy maintenance regimen, for treatment of adults with mycosis fungoides, for treatment of adults with relapsed or refractory non- Hodgkin lymphoma as part of a metronomic combination regimen, for treatment of adults with rheumatoid arthritis, and for treatment of adults with severe psoriasis.
